How to Disable Unnecessary Startup Apps in Windows 11


Windows 11 automatically launches various apps at startup, which can slow down your computer. To improve startup speed, users can disable unnecessary apps. Access this feature through Settings > Apps > Startup, then toggle off apps you don’t need. This action boosts performance and system responsiveness while conserving resources.


Your Windows 11 computer starts many programs automatically when you turn it on. Some of these apps you use all the time, so it makes sense. But others you might not need right away, and having too many apps start up can make your computer slower to start.

By turning off apps you don’t need to start automatically, your PC can start faster and work better.

See Which Apps Start Automatically

Look at the little icons near the clock on your taskbar (bottom-right corner). These show some apps running in the background.

If you don’t see all icons, click the ^ (up arrow) button to “Show hidden icons.”

These are some programs that start automatically, but there might be others you don’t see here.

How to Turn Off Startup Apps You Don’t Need

Follow these simple steps to stop apps from starting automatically:

  1. Open Settings: Click the Start menu (Windows icon at bottom-left), then click Settings.

    Or press Windows key + I on your keyboard to open Settings quickly.
  2. In the Settings window, click on Apps in the left menu.
  3. Now, click Startup on the right side.
    Windows 11 Apps Startup settings page
  4. You’ll see a list of apps that start automatically. Find apps you don’t need right away and switch their toggle to Off.
    Turning off startup apps in Windows 11

That’s it! Next time you start your computer, those apps won’t open automatically, and your PC will start faster.

Why Do This?

  • Turning off unneeded startup apps helps your computer start quicker.
  • It can make your computer feel faster and more responsive.
  • You save system resources, so your apps and games run better.
  • You stay in control of what runs on your PC.

Remember: Some programs are important to keep on startup (like antivirus software). Only turn off apps you recognize and don’t need right away.
